Datasheet
Rev.7.00 Feb. 14, 2007  page xxvi of xxxii 
REJ09B0089-0700 
17.1.2  Register Configuration.........................................................................................566 
17.2  Register Descriptions........................................................................................................566 
17.2.1  Mode Control Register (MDCR) .........................................................................566 
17.2.2  Bus Control Register L (BCRL) ..........................................................................567 
17.3  Operation...........................................................................................................................567 
17.4  Overview of Flash Memory (H8S/2318 F-ZTAT, H8S/2317 F-ZTAT, 
  H8S/2315 F-ZTAT, H8S/2314 F-ZTAT)..........................................................................571
17.4.1  Features................................................................................................................571 
17.4.2  Overview..............................................................................................................572 
17.4.3  Flash Memory Operating Modes .........................................................................573 
17.4.4  On-Board Programming Modes...........................................................................574 
17.4.5  Flash Memory Emulation in RAM ......................................................................576 
17.4.6  Differences between Boot Mode and User Program Mode .................................577 
17.4.7  Block Configuration.............................................................................................578 
17.4.8  Pin Configuration.................................................................................................579 
17.4.9  Register Configuration.........................................................................................580 
17.5  Register Descriptions........................................................................................................581 
17.5.1  Flash Memory Control Register 1 (FLMCR1).....................................................581 
17.5.2  Flash Memory Control Register 2 (FLMCR2).....................................................584 
17.5.3  Erase Block Register 1 (EBR1) ...........................................................................585 
17.5.4  Erase Block Register 2 (EBR2) ...........................................................................585 
17.5.5  System Control Register 2 (SYSCR2).................................................................586 
17.5.6  RAM Emulation Register (RAMER)...................................................................587 
17.6  On-Board Programming Modes........................................................................................589 
17.6.1  Boot Mode ...........................................................................................................590 
17.6.2  User Program Mode.............................................................................................595 
17.7  Programming/Erasing Flash Memory...............................................................................597 
17.7.1  Program Mode .....................................................................................................597 
17.7.2  Program-Verify Mode..........................................................................................598 
17.7.3  Erase Mode ..........................................................................................................600 
17.7.4  Erase-Verify Mode...............................................................................................600 
17.8  Flash Memory Protection..................................................................................................602 
17.8.1  Hardware Protection ............................................................................................602 
17.8.2  Software Protection..............................................................................................602 
17.8.3  Error Protection....................................................................................................603 
17.9  Flash Memory Emulation in RAM ...................................................................................605 
17.9.1  Emulation in RAM...............................................................................................605 
17.9.2  RAM Overlap ......................................................................................................606 
17.10 Interrupt Handling when Programming/Erasing Flash Memory.......................................607 
17.11 Flash Memory Programmer Mode....................................................................................608 










